Responsibilities and Challenges - Group Head of Health, Safety & Environment (HSE)
You will own the country HSE function and take full responsibility for all elements of Health, Safety & Environmental across the Group
Empowered to lead the Health, Safety & Environmental function across the business
Lead the Health and Safety agenda across Operations, Engineering and facilities management service providers, ensuring legal compliance
Coach and mentor the HS&E and facilities support teams
Leads BBS (Behaviour Based Safety) program
Embed a strategic HSE framework of world-class safety standards
Leadership role providing direction, guidance, and support on the HSE & Wellbeing strategy
Responsible for all HSE legal compliance, driving and fostering a safe, high-performing working environment
Develop, maintain and deliver legal compliance
Act as the subject matter expert for HSE
Generate and deliver a robust risk management strategy
Direct line management of Health & Safety Advisors across sites
You will work with and influence Site Leads and senior managers, and stakeholders in each of the sites and factories
Role Requirements - Group Head of Health, Safety & Environment (HSE)
Ability to lead, visibly, engaging all levels of the site; a natural ability to influence, engage and drive HSE cultural change through your direct reports
Comfortable working at a strategic level, naturally
NEBOSH Diploma, ideally chartered IOSH or working towards chartership or IEMA would be advantageous
Empower all levels of workforce, floor to the SLT
Visible and approachable - ALWAYS!
Delivering an effective framework for safety program management
Key interface with the HSE systems, policies, and procedures and UK & Corporate Behavioural Change through thousands of people
Execute a Health and Safety Plan for the UK manufacturing Division, drive improvements in site operations, HSE performance and cultural change
Serve as mentor and trainer for SLT members, key stakeholders’ managers and other key supply chain leaders
Environmental compliance experience linked to sustainability and Net 0 initiatives
Experience working within an FMCG/fast-paced manufacturing environment within an HSE leadership role, ideally multi-site, time sensitive and complex
Demonstrable experience of developing safe systems of work, carrying out H&S Audits, conducting risk assessments and delivering training
A driving license is essential
